Britain declared war on Germany on September 3, 1939. This declaration came shortly after Germany invaded Poland on September 1, 1939, prompting Britain and France to respond in defense of Poland. The formal declaration marked the beginning of Britain's involvement in World War II.

In 1938, Hitler ordered the German army into Austria. Later that same year, thousands of Jewish shops and hundreds of Synagogues are burned down. In 1939, Germany invades Czechoslovakia. On September 1, Germany attacks Poland. France and The UK declare war on Germany two days later, and the war in Europe begins.
